Topography in e-cigarette users
Reference | Study characteristics Study product/sample Size | Traditional cigarette | Use duration e-cigarette | Use duration traditional cigarette | Results e-cigarette topography | Traditional cigarette topography | Other topography measures |
---|---|---|---|---|---|---|---|
Etter and Bullen26 | Varied brands | N/A | Mean=3 months | N/A | 120 puffs/day | N/A | N/A |
Hua et al28 | Preferred e-cigarette, flavour, nicotine concentration/64-e-cigarette users; 9 traditional cigarette users | Preferred traditional cigarette flavour, nicotine concentration | Ad libitum | Ad libitum | Puff duration 4.3 s, SD ±1.5; exhalation duration 1.7 s, SD 1.1 | Puff duration 2.4 s, SD ±0.8; exhalation duration 1.6 s, SD 0.7 | Observational data; e-cigarette users showed large variation in puff duration |
Farsalinos et al 3 | eGo-T battery, Epsilon atomiser, Nobacco 9 mg/mL nicotine/45 e-cigarette users; 35 traditional cigarette users | 2 cigarette cigarettes (brand not identified) | Ad libitum for 20 min for experienced users; ad libitum for 10 min for naïve users | 2 cigarette cigarettes ad libitum, 00.7 mg nicotine | E-cigarette user puff duration 4.2±0.7, inhalation 1.3±0.4 s; puff number=43; traditional cigarette users using e-cigarettes puff duration 2.3±0.5, inhalation 2.1±0.4 s | Puff duration 2.1±0.4 and inhalation 2.1±0.4 s | Observational data; nicotine absorption was not measured |
Trtchounian et al14 | Liberty Stix, Crown Seven Hydro Kit, NJOY, Smoking Everywhere Gold | Merit Ultra Lights, Marlboro Ultra Lights, Marlboro Lights, Marlboro Reds, Camel unfiltered, Camel Lights, Camel filtered, Pall Mall unfiltered | First 10 puffs of an e-cigarette | 7–11 puffs; puffs were 2.2 s long every minute; 3 series | Average vacuums ranged from 25±3 mm H2O to 153±12 mmH2O | Average vacuums ranged from 30 mm H2O±3 to 80 mm H2O±5 | Machine yield data from non-standardized, non-validated topography equipment |
Trtchounian et al14 | Liberty Stix, Crown Seven Hydro Kit, NJOY, Smoking Everywhere Gold, VapCigs | N/A | Vacuum and aerosol density measured until each cartridge was exhausted, 3 series | N/A | Average vacuums ranged from 34±6 mm H2O to 174±23 mmH2O; puffs ranged from 177±15 to 313±115. | N/A | Machine yield data from non-standardized, non-validated topography equipment |
Williams and Talbot30* | Liberty Stix #1, Liberty Stix #2, VapCigs, Crown Seven Hydro Imperial, Smoking Everywhere Platinum | N/A | First 10 puffs of an e-cigarette | N/A | Pressure drop, flow rate and aerosol density remained constant for a given e-cigarette but varied among brands. Liberty Stix had the lowest pressure drop (20 mm H2O) and Liberty Stix #2 had the highest pressure drop (150 mm H2O) | N/A | Machine yield data from non-standardized, non-validated topography equipment |
Williams and Talbot30* | VapCigs #2, Crown Seven Hydro Imperial, Smoking Everywhere Platinum | N/A | Aerosol density measured until each cartridge was exhausted, 3 series | N/A | Puffs ranged from 160±6 to 400±10. | N/A | Machine yield data from non-standardized, non-validated topography equipment |
Williams and Talbot30* | Liberty Stix #1, Liberty Stix #2 | N/A | 11 puffs, 3 series | N/A | Aerosol density remained similar for the first e-cigarette so performed quite uniformly from trial to trial. In contrast, pressure dropped significantly during trial 3 for the second cigarette with a drop in aerosol density | N/A | Pressure drop was consistent for Liberty Stix #1 so performed uniformly; Liberty Stix #2 did not perform uniformly; machine yield data from non-standardized, non-validated topography equipment |
*One Liberty Stix and one VapCigs e-cigarette from prior study (Trtchounian et al14) were included in this study. The original purchases are designated Liberty Stix #1 and VapCigs #1; the purchases used only in this study are designated Liberty Stix #2 and VapCigs #2.
